New Issue: HSBC sells $2.63 million autocallable barrier notes with step-up premium on Nvidia, AMD
By William Gullotti
Buffalo, N.Y., Sept. 26 – HSBC USA Inc. priced $2.63 million of 0% autocallable barrier notes with step-up premium due Sept. 26, 2025 linked to the performance of the stocks of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. and Nvidia Corp., according to a 424B2 fil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.
The notes will be called at par plus an 19% annualized call premium if each stock closes at or above its call level, 85% of initial level, on any monthly observation date starting Dec. 21.
If each stock finishes at or above call level, the payout at maturity will be par plus 57%.
If the worst performer finishes below its call level but at or above its 60% barrier level, the payout will be par. Otherwise, investors will lose 1% for each 1% decline of the worst performer from its initial level.
HSBC Securities (USA) Inc. is the agent.
